    Understanding Salmon Cooking Times

    Cooking salmon in the microwave requires understanding various factors that influence the cooking time. Different conditions can lead to different outcomes, so being aware of these factors is essential for perfecting your dish.

    Factors Affecting Cooking Time

    Cooking time for salmon fluctuates based on several factors:

    • Weight: The heavier the salmon, the longer it takes to cook. A 6-ounce filet cooks faster than an 8-ounce filet.
    • Thickness: Thicker cuts need more time compared to thinner ones. For instance, a 1-inch thick filet takes longer than a ½-inch thick one.
    • Starting Temperature: Salmon cooked straight from the fridge requires more time than room-temperature salmon.
    • Microwave Wattage: Higher wattage microwaves cook food faster. A 1000-watt microwave cooks salmon more quickly than a 700-watt microwave.

    Different Salmon Cuts and Their Times

    Different salmon cuts require different cooking times in the microwave. Here’s a breakdown:

    Salmon Cut Cooking Time (Minutes)
    Salmon Fillet (6 oz) 4-5
    Salmon Fillet (8 oz) 5-6
    Salmon Steak (6 oz) 5-6
    Salmon Steak (8 oz) 6-8
    Salmon Whole (1 lb) 8-10

    For optimal results, check for an internal temperature of 145°F. Adjust times based on your microwave’s power and your salmon’s size. Always cover the salmon with a microwave-safe lid or wrap to maintain moisture and promote even cooking.

    Steps to Cook Salmon in the Microwave

    Cooking salmon in the microwave is simple and quick, perfect for a busy schedule. Follow these steps for succulent results.

    Preparing the Salmon

    1. Thaw the Salmon: If using frozen salmon, thaw it in the fridge for several hours or use the microwave’s defrost setting for a few minutes.
    2. Pat It Dry: Use paper towels to gently pat the salmon dry. This helps remove excess moisture and enhances the cooking process.
    3. Season the Salmon: Add your favorite seasonings. Salt, pepper, lemon juice, and herbs work well. You can also use marinades for added flavor.
    4. Place in a Dish: Put the salmon in a microwave-safe dish. Ensure there’s space around it for even heating.
    5. Cover the Dish: Use a microwave-safe lid or wrap to cover the dish. This traps steam, helping the salmon cook evenly and stay moist.

    1. Set Power Level: Adjust the microwave to 70% power for even cooking. Lower power prevents the salmon from overcooking on the edges before the center is done.
    2. Determine Cooking Time: Cook salmon fillets for about 4-6 minutes per 6 ounces. For thicker cuts, increase the time as needed. Always check for doneness.
    3. Monitor Progress: After the initial cooking time, check the salmon. If it’s not cooked through, continue microwaving in 30-second increments until it reaches a safe internal temperature of 145°F.
    4. Let It Rest: Allow the salmon to rest for a minute after cooking. This helps redistribute the juices, making for a more flavorful meal.

    Tips for Perfectly Cooked Salmon

    Follow these tips to achieve perfectly cooked salmon every time you use the microwave.

    Avoiding Overcooking

    • Check regularly. Start with shorter cooking times, especially if you’re unsure about thickness.
    • Use a fork. Gently flake the fish at the thickest part to see if it’s opaque and separates easily.
    • Reduce power. Cook at 70% power to ensure even cooking and avoid tough texture.
    • Rest the salmon. Let it sit for a minute after cooking. This allows residual heat to finish the cooking process without further heat exposure.
    • Add seasonings. Try salt, pepper, lemon juice, or herbs to elevate your dish. Fresh dill or thyme pairs well with salmon.
    • Use marinades. Marinate your salmon for 15-30 minutes before cooking for added flavor. Soy sauce, honey, and garlic create a delicious glaze.
    • Include aromatics. Place lemon slices, garlic cloves, or onion wedges in the dish for extra flavor infusion.
    • Experiment with toppings. Consider adding breadcrumbs or Parmesan for a crunchy finish. Sprinkle these on top before microwaving.

    Common Mistakes to Avoid

    Avoiding mistakes leads to better results when cooking salmon in the microwave. Here are key errors to watch for:

    Misunderstanding Cooking Times

    Understanding cooking times ensures perfectly cooked salmon. Many people underestimate the time needed based on the thickness and weight of the fish. For example, a 6-ounce salmon fillet typically cooks in 4-6 minutes. Cooking at lower power, like 70%, helps prevent overcooking. Rushing the process leads to uneven results. Always use a food thermometer to check for the safe internal temperature of 145°F.

    Ignoring Safety Guidelines

    Ignoring safety guidelines can lead to foodborne illnesses. Ensure salmon is cooked from a safe temperature, especially if previously frozen. Thawing properly in the fridge prevents harmful bacteria growth. Use microwave-safe dishes to avoid chemical leaching and burns. Covering the dish not only maintains moisture but also protects against splatters. Always let the salmon rest for about a minute after cooking to stabilize temperature and enhance flavor.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    How long does it take to cook salmon in the microwave?

    Cooking salmon in the microwave typically takes about 4-6 minutes per 6 ounces of fillet at 70% power. Cooking time may vary based on the thickness, weight, and wattage of your microwave, so it’s important to monitor the salmon as it cooks.

    What temperature should salmon be cooked to?

    Salmon should be cooked to an internal temperature of 145°F to ensure it’s safe to eat. Using a food thermometer helps verify that the fish has reached the proper doneness.

    How do I prevent overcooking salmon in the microwave?

    To prevent overcooking, cook salmon at 70% power and start with shorter cooking times. Checking the salmon periodically will help you catch it at the right moment for optimal texture.

    Can I cook frozen salmon in the microwave?

    Yes, you can cook frozen salmon in the microwave. However, it’s best to thaw it in the refrigerator first for even cooking. If cooked directly from frozen, you may need to adjust the cooking time to ensure it heats thoroughly.

    Should I cover the salmon while microwaving?

    Yes, covering the salmon with a microwave-safe lid or wrap is essential. This helps maintain moisture, ensures even cooking, and prevents splatters, making cleanup easier.

    How can I add flavor to microwave-cooked salmon?

    You can add flavor by seasoning the salmon with your choice of spices, marinades, or aromatics like lemon slices and garlic before cooking. Marinating the salmon beforehand can enhance its taste.
